Summary
How do we respond when money is tight or when we reach a point of financial crisis? This can bring feelings of anxiety and overwhelm to any person especially when it seems we don't have enough to cover the essentials. On this episode we hope to reduce the panic financial upheaval can bring and discuss some tangible ways to care for ourselves and our budgets when things aren't going 'according to plan'.

What Jen+Jill have to say:
- 1. Maximize liquid cash
- 2. Make a budget: know how much you have coming in/going out each month (helps ID how much you should have in emergency fund)
- 3. Prepare to Minimize Your Monthly Bills
- 5. Take stock of ‘non-cash’ assets and maximize value (i.e. utilize points, gift cards, extra food in house,
- 8. Look for ways to earn extra cash
- 10. Keep up with routine maintenance

More from Jen+Jill:
- Remain calm
- Ask for help- friends and family, financial planner
- Reframe the situation - watch the internal narrative and find ways to shift perspective
- Pushing through the difficulty and identifying ‘kindness’ to invest emotional time and energy into
- Take a break - strike the middle ground between ruminating/obsessing and abdicating/avoiding
- Ask for help- find a mental health professional, especially if your stress, overwhelm, or feelings of anxiety are inhibiting daily activities
